Magnesium Glycinate: The Relaxation and Sleep Enhancer

Magnesium glycinate is a compound of magnesium and glycine, an amino acid celebrated for its calming effects. This form stands out due to its high bioavailability, meaning your body can absorb it efficiently. Glycine itself acts as a neurotransmitter that can promote relaxation, reduce anxiety, and improve sleep quality. Magnesium glycinate is often the top recommendation for individuals seeking to enhance their sleep because it combines the benefits of magnesium with the inherent calming properties of glycine.

How Magnesium Glycinate Promotes Sleep

Magnesium glycinate supports sleep through multiple pathways. Magnesium is crucial in regulating neurotransmitters like GABA (gamma-aminobutyric acid), which promotes relaxation and reduces nerve activity. By enhancing GABA activity, magnesium helps calm the mind and prepare the body for sleep. Glycine also works on GABA receptors, synergistically enhancing these calming effects. This combination helps reduce anxiety and promotes a sense of calm, making it easier to both fall asleep and stay asleep throughout the night. In fact, a randomized, placebo-controlled trial demonstrated that magnesium bisglycinate supplementation improved sleep quality in healthy adults who reported experiencing poor sleep (Schuster, 2025). This suggests that magnesium glycinate can be particularly beneficial for those struggling with insomnia or restless sleep.

Benefits of Magnesium Glycinate

  • Improved Sleep Quality: Several studies indicate that magnesium glycinate can improve sleep duration, depth, and overall quality [5]. By promoting relaxation and reducing nighttime awakenings, it helps you achieve more restorative sleep.
  • Reduced Anxiety: Magnesium plays a significant role in modulating the body's stress response system. A systematic review showed that supplemental magnesium can effectively reduce anxiety symptoms (Rawji, 2024). This is particularly beneficial for individuals whose sleep is disrupted by racing thoughts or feelings of unease.
  • Enhanced Relaxation: The glycine component of magnesium glycinate further promotes relaxation, helping you unwind and prepare for sleep. Glycine has been shown to lower body temperature and promote a sense of calm, both of which are conducive to sleep.

Dosage and Considerations for Magnesium Glycinate

The typical dosage of magnesium glycinate for sleep typically ranges from 200 to 400 mg, taken about one hour before bedtime. It is generally well-tolerated, but some individuals may experience mild digestive issues, such as nausea or diarrhea, especially at higher doses. It’s always advisable to start with a lower dose — such as 100-200mg — and gradually increase it to assess your body's response. Magnesium L-Threonate: The Cognitive and Sleep Supporter

Magnesium L-threonate is a relatively newer form of magnesium that has garnered attention for its potential cognitive benefits. It is believed to be more effective at crossing the blood-brain barrier compared to other forms of magnesium, allowing it to directly influence brain function. While research on its sleep-specific benefits is still emerging, magnesium L-threonate shows promise for those seeking to support both cognitive health and sleep. This form of magnesium is unique because it has been shown to increase magnesium concentration in the brain more effectively than other forms.

How Magnesium L-Threonate Influences Sleep

Magnesium L-threonate increases magnesium levels in the brain, which can enhance synaptic plasticity — the ability of brain cells to form new connections. This is crucial for learning, memory, and overall cognitive function, but it also indirectly affects sleep. By improving brain function and reducing neuronal excitability, magnesium L-threonate may help regulate sleep cycles and reduce sleep disturbances. A study in Sleep Medicine: X found that magnesium-L-threonate improves sleep quality and daytime functioning in adults with self-reported sleep problems (Hausenblas, 2024). This suggests that by optimizing brain health, magnesium L-threonate can contribute to more restful and restorative sleep.

Benefits of Magnesium L-Threonate

  • Cognitive Enhancement: Magnesium L-threonate is primarily recognized for its ability to improve memory, learning, and overall cognitive performance. It supports synaptic connections and enhances brain plasticity, making it a valuable supplement for those seeking to boost cognitive function.
  • Potential Sleep Improvement: By supporting brain health and reducing neuronal excitability, it may indirectly improve sleep quality [8]. This can be particularly beneficial for individuals whose sleep is disrupted by cognitive overactivity or mental restlessness.
  • Anxiety Reduction: Some research suggests that magnesium L-threonate can help reduce anxiety, which can contribute to better sleep. By modulating stress hormones and promoting a sense of calm, it helps create an environment conducive to sleep.

Dosage and Considerations for Magnesium L-Threonate

The typical dosage of magnesium L-threonate is around 144 mg of elemental magnesium per day, often divided into three doses taken throughout the day. It is generally considered safe, but more research is needed to fully understand its long-term effects. Because of its cognitive-enhancing effects, some individuals may prefer to take it earlier in the day rather than right before bed to avoid any potential stimulation that could interfere with sleep. Magnesium Citrate: The Bowel Movement Promoter

Magnesium citrate is a form of magnesium combined with citric acid. It’s well-known for its laxative effects and is often used to treat constipation. While it does provide magnesium, it may not be the best choice for improving sleep due to its potential to cause digestive upset. However, for individuals who struggle with both constipation and poor sleep, magnesium citrate might offer a dual benefit — although careful consideration is needed to avoid disrupting sleep with frequent bathroom trips. It's important to weigh the potential benefits against the risk of digestive side effects when considering magnesium citrate for sleep.

How Magnesium Citrate Works

Magnesium citrate works by drawing water into the intestines, which softens the stool and promotes bowel movements. While this can be highly effective for relieving constipation, it can also lead to diarrhea, abdominal discomfort, and dehydration if not used carefully. The increased bowel activity can also disrupt sleep, making it less restful. Benefits of Magnesium Citrate

  • Constipation Relief: Magnesium citrate is highly effective for treating occasional constipation [3]. It works quickly to soften stool and promote bowel movements, making it a reliable option for those struggling with irregularity.
  • Magnesium Supplementation: Provides a source of magnesium, which is essential for various bodily functions. While not the primary reason for its use, magnesium citrate does contribute to overall magnesium intake.

Dosage and Considerations for Magnesium Citrate

The dosage of magnesium citrate for constipation varies depending on the product and the severity of the condition, but it’s typically higher than the dosage recommended for sleep. It’s important to take it with plenty of water to avoid dehydration. Due to its laxative effects, it’s generally not recommended to take magnesium citrate right before bed unless you are specifically targeting constipation relief. The potential for digestive upset and frequent bathroom trips could significantly disrupt your sleep. For sleep purposes, other forms of magnesium are generally preferred.

Navigating Potential Drug Interactions

Magnesium can interact with certain medications, such as antibiotics, diuretics, and proton pump inhibitors. These interactions can either reduce the absorption of magnesium or increase its excretion, potentially diminishing its effectiveness. If you are currently taking any medications, it's essential to discuss magnesium supplementation with your healthcare provider to ensure it is safe for you. They can advise you on the best way to avoid potential interactions and optimize the benefits of magnesium. It is also important to note that magnesium can enhance the effects of muscle relaxants and other sedatives, so caution is advised when combining these substances.
